Mystery over bright flashes in night sky over Belper

Three unexplained bright flashes in the night sky have left a Belper couple spooked – now they want to know if anyone else witnessed the events.

Tricia and John Booth, of William Street, were left shocked and puzzled after they were woken up by their phone loudly resetting itself, at 1.45am, on Saturday, December 20. Then when they looked up through their bedroom skylight they saw three bright flashes.

The couple are struggling to explain the flashes, which occurred about 20 seconds apart, and the phone resetting itself as none of their neighbours had any similar experiences.

Mrs Booth said: "There was no rain, no sound of thunder, nothing except these bright flashes that came on and off like light switches. We can't stop thinking about it. Maybe it was a thunderstorm, but why did nothing else in the house reset itself, like the microwave or the video?

"It could have been fireworks, but it was too late at night I think, and the all-over flash was unlike a firework. It looked fairly like sheet lightning, only there was no noise at all, no rain and not much cloud. It could possibly even have been a police helicopter with searchlights, but they make a lot of noise overhead.

"I wish I knew somebody who saw this, but, of course, most people were not only asleep, behind curtains, but they had no reason to wake up since their was no noise.

"I'm hoping somebody who was out in town late, either after a night out, or working, or a policeman, noticed it."

The couple have been asking around since it happened, but have not yet found anyone who saw the flashes.

They are now appealing for anyone who saw the flashes to come forward to see if they can explain them.
